Wondering what is musical instruments doing inside session on ‘periodic tables’? We began with exploring different musical instruments …. primarily how each was different because of the metal they were made off…

Children observed that they had different feel, texture, colour, hardness, weight etc other than sound being different.

We wondered what makes them different?

Then explored how they could be different ATOMS or some could be a combination of atoms – hence different molecules (brass).

We explored how each Atom is different (Atomic weight), how electrons are arranged and hence how each atom either wants to give or take electrons or is very stable like Helium.

Ended up looking at the periodic table with some familiar names and some very exotic names.
